3 Typical Causes of Water Stains on Wall Surfaces


As opposed to popular belief, water discolorations on walls do not constantly come from inadequate structure products. There are several root causes of water discolorations on wall surfaces. These consist of:

Poor Water drainage


When making a structure plan, it is vital to guarantee sufficient drain. This will certainly stop water from permeating right into the wall surfaces. Where the drain system is obstructed or missing, underground moisture develops. This web links to excessive dampness that you discover on the wall surfaces of your building.
So, the leading root cause of damp wall surfaces, in this situation, can be a bad water drainage system. It can additionally result from inadequate management of sewer pipelines that run through the building.

Wet


When warm moist air consults with completely dry chilly air, it causes water beads to form on the wall surfaces of structures. This takes place in bathrooms as well as kitchens when there is vapor from food preparation or showers. The water droplets can discolor the surrounding walls in these parts of your residence as well as spread to various other locations.
Damp or condensation impacts the roofing system and also walls of structures. When the wall is damp, it produces an ideal atmosphere for the growth of fungi and microbes.

Pipe Leaks


Most homes have a network of water pipelines within the walls. It constantly increases the stability of such pipelines, as there is little oxygen within the walls.
A disadvantage to this is that water leak impacts the walls of the building as well as triggers prevalent damages. A dead giveaway of defective pipes is the look of a water discolor on the wall surface.

    How to Remove Water Stains From Your Walls Without Repainting


    The easy way to get water stains off walls


    Water stains aren’t going to appear on tile; they need a more absorbent surface, which is why they show up on bare walls. Since your walls are probably painted, this presents a problem: How can you wash a wall without damaging it and risk needing to repait the entire room?


    According to Igloo Surfaces, you should start gently and only increase the intensity of your cleaning methods if basic remedies don’t get the job done. Start with a simple solution of dish soap and warm water, at a ratio of about one to two. Use a cloth dipped in the mixture to apply the soapy water to your stain. Gently rub it in from the top down, then rinse with plain water and dry thoroughly with a hair dryer on a cool setting.



    If that doesn’t work, fill a spray bottle with a mixture of vinegar, lemon juice, and baking soda. Shake it up and spray it on the stain. Leave it for about an hour, then use a damp cloth to rub it away. You may have to repeat this process a few times to get the stain all the way out, so do this when you have time for multiple hour-long soaking intervals.


    How to get water stains out of wood


    Maybe you have wood paneling or cabinets that are looking grody from water stains too, whether in your kitchen or bathroom. Per Better Homes and Gardens, you have a few options for removing water marks on your wooden surfaces.


  • You can let mayonnaise sit on your stain overnight, then wipe it away in the morning and polish your wood afterward.


  • You can also mix equal parts vinegar and olive oil and apply to the stain with a cloth, wiping in the direction of the grain until the stain disappears. Afterward, wipe the surface down with a clean, dry cloth.


  • Try placing an iron on a low heat setting over a cloth on top of the stain. Press it down for a few seconds and remove it to see if the stain is letting up, then try again until you’re satisfied. (Be advised that this works best for still-damp stains.)
